When formal events like proms, weddings and special parties and galas come around, a naturalista may become nervous about how to style her hair. Not to fret! There are plenty of natural styles that are beautiful and elegant, and perfect for formal events. Try these when you have your next big event.

Updos and Hair Ornamentation

You can never go wrong with an updo when it comes to a formal occasion. All you’ll need are bobby pins, a rat tail comb, brush, and holding gel to complete the look. An updo works easily with a long flowing gown or a short cocktail dress. Play around with variations of braided, sectioned or twisted updos, and have the rest of your hair pinned up neatly in a chignon twist.

Flat twists, or sectioning the hair and combining it all to sweep up with the rest of the hair are great options, and easy to do if you don’t know how to cornrow your own hair. Parting your hair at different angles and adding hair ornamentation will add further luxury, sparkle, and pizazz to the style.

Bun Variations

The bun can be worn many ways- up and neat, messy, to the side, at the nape of the neck- all these options can work with elegant and sophisticated formal wear.

The Fro-Hawk

The fro-hawk is funky and trendy, but it is also a very elegant style. As with an updo, you can play around with parting or sectioning the hair at the sides with braids or twists and adding ornamentation, or just sweeping it up and pinning it so the hair sits in the middle softly. Tip- put your hair in bantu knots the night before to have a spiraled and voluminous hawk the next day.
